WESTFIELD — The NEB boys earned a quad-meet sweep to end the NTL dual meet season on Tuesday.
The Panthers beat Wellsboro (15-45), NPM (21-36), and CV (16-43).
NPM’s James Knefley (17:33) won the race but was followed by four Panthers: Jackson Martin (17:38), Levi Dewing (18:33), Russell Martin (18:41), and Xavier Lockwood (18:54).
NEB’s Josiah Russell (19:19) was eighth to secure the win for NEB.
The Lady Panthers went 1-2 on the day, beating NPM (23-29) but falling to CV (27-28) and Wellsboro (24-33).
Wellsboro’s Lauren Kosek (21:08) out kicked NPM’s Jaci Fairchild (21:09) to go undefeated on the dual meet season.
NEB’s Sophie Bennett (21:13) took third with teammate Ruth Laudermilch (22:29) fifth. Clara Dewing (28:10) came in 12th, and Riley Lamson (33:06) was 16th.
NEB’s Julia Laudermilch (9:56) won the junior high girls’ race to go undefeated during the dual meet season.
Jesse Dewing (9:57) was the top NEB boys, taking second.
